Runbook: Scanline barcode bridge

If warehouse scans stop flowing into Cartwheel, it's almost always the bridge service on the Dunmore floor box wedging after a USB hiccup. Bounce the service first — nine times out of ten that fixes it. If not, check the queue depth before escalating. When restarting, make sure the bridge comes up with these settings.

deployment values, yafop-bajef:
[gilok]
team = ulaius
access_code = ac_423664
host = gilok.sivrelhq.corp
port = 9200
owner = pelius.istax
peer = eliok.torvasoft.internal

**Handover: Splitgate assignment service (Orvik → Delma)**

Splitgate handles experiment bucketing for all plugins. Assignments are deterministic per user and experiment key, so plugin authors should never cache them locally. The sticky-assignment edge cases around mid-experiment ramp changes are the main gotcha. The full integration guide for plugin authors lives on our internal page.

runbook for badug-kadup: https://confluence.zemvarlabs.internal/projects/browse/display/projects/bd1b

## Tuning dark mode

The Quillboard admin dashboard computes dark-mode colors at runtime rather than shipping a second stylesheet. Support staff occasionally need to adjust contrast for customers reporting readability issues, especially on older panels. All adjustments happen through a small set of constants — never edit component styles directly, or the theme engine in Brightlea will overwrite them on the next deploy. The relevant knobs are listed below.

tuning table, faduf-baduf:
PRIORITIES = {
    "ulavan": 191,
    "silys": 750,
    "goriel": 238,
    "kelmir": 66,
    "wendor": 432,
}

## Relevance Tuning — Querel Search

This week we adjusted the BM25 field boosts on the Querel index after the Marston team flagged weak recall on partial product names. Title boost was lowered, synonym expansion re-enabled for the catalog analyzer, and the rescore window widened. Please review carefully before the sync — these settings interact with the phrase-slop change from last sprint. The active configuration on the primary cluster is as follows.

service settings:
PRAIX_LOG_LEVEL=error
PRAIX_METRICS_HOST=metrics.praix.qorvelcorp.corp
PRAIX_POOL_SIZE=16